How to contact our local Police

Following on from PC Monks’ attendance at the parish council meeting in October the following information may be of interest to residents:

For emergencies:

  • Always ring 999.

For non-emergencies:

  • Phone 101 – The Parish Council has been assured the service has improved after residents reported issues with calls not being answered.

Cheshire Police would also like to raise awareness of hawkers in the area who have been selling door to door without a licence (obtained from the local police station). If residents are concerned at any point please contact Cheshire Police.
